Transaction 125dd0feb8bc94a011036df8302adcc7566cdc011e56c615833702bc71e6b1ba
2 Input
2 Outputs
- 125dd0feb8bc94a011036df8302adcc7566cdc011e56c615833702bc71e6b1ba:0
- 125dd0feb8bc94a011036df8302adcc7566cdc011e56c615833702bc71e6b1ba:1
value 422155
address 16WbRLKX18VjP8SaUi2ZejRPCgFEBR3s8d
value 18280000
address 177m2wwHsHQxt5x34Y3aqSSTWf8zi4ELTm